A huge early break was getting the role of Marius in the original London production of Les Misrables in 1985, co-directed by Trevor Nunn, then the artistic director of the Royal Shakespeare Company. Im really proud of so much of what Ive been able to do., Balls mother was a teacher, and his father was an apprentice at the Longbridge car plant who worked his way up and became a sales director, which meant the family moved around a lot, including three years spent in South Africa.
